
io.kabanero.v1alpha2.models.KabaneroStatus Maven / Gradle / Ivy
/*
* Kubernetes
* No description provided (generated by Openapi Generator https://github.com/openapitools/openapi-generator)
*
* The version of the OpenAPI document: v1.17.0
*
*
* NOTE: This class is auto generated by OpenAPI Generator (https://openapi-generator.tech).
* https://openapi-generator.tech
* Do not edit the class manually.
*/
package io.kabanero.v1alpha2.models;
import org.apache.commons.lang3.builder.EqualsBuilder;
import org.apache.commons.lang3.builder.HashCodeBuilder;
import com.google.gson.annotations.SerializedName;
import io.kabanero.v1alpha2.models.KabaneroStatusAdmissionControllerWebhook;
import io.kabanero.v1alpha2.models.KabaneroStatusAppsody;
import io.kabanero.v1alpha2.models.KabaneroStatusCli;
import io.kabanero.v1alpha2.models.KabaneroStatusCodereadyWorkspaces;
import io.kabanero.v1alpha2.models.KabaneroStatusCollectionController;
import io.kabanero.v1alpha2.models.KabaneroStatusEvents;
import io.kabanero.v1alpha2.models.KabaneroStatusKabaneroInstance;
import io.kabanero.v1alpha2.models.KabaneroStatusKappnav;
import io.kabanero.v1alpha2.models.KabaneroStatusLanding;
import io.kabanero.v1alpha2.models.KabaneroStatusServerless;
import io.kabanero.v1alpha2.models.KabaneroStatusSso;
import io.kabanero.v1alpha2.models.KabaneroStatusStackController;
import io.kabanero.v1alpha2.models.KabaneroStatusTekton;
import io.swagger.annotations.ApiModel;
import io.swagger.annotations.ApiModelProperty;
/**
* KabaneroStatus defines the observed state of the Kabanero instance.
*/
@ApiModel(description = "KabaneroStatus defines the observed state of the Kabanero instance.")
@javax.annotation.Generated(value = "org.openapitools.codegen.languages.JavaClientCodegen", date = "2020-02-06T20:45:49.673Z[Etc/UTC]")
public class KabaneroStatus {
public static final String SERIALIZED_NAME_ADMISSION_CONTROLLER_WEBHOOK = "admissionControllerWebhook";
@SerializedName(SERIALIZED_NAME_ADMISSION_CONTROLLER_WEBHOOK)
private KabaneroStatusAdmissionControllerWebhook admissionControllerWebhook;
public static final String SERIALIZED_NAME_APPSODY = "appsody";
@SerializedName(SERIALIZED_NAME_APPSODY)
private KabaneroStatusAppsody appsody;
public static final String SERIALIZED_NAME_CLI = "cli";
@SerializedName(SERIALIZED_NAME_CLI)
private KabaneroStatusCli cli;
public static final String SERIALIZED_NAME_CODEREADY_WORKSPACES = "codereadyWorkspaces";
@SerializedName(SERIALIZED_NAME_CODEREADY_WORKSPACES)
private KabaneroStatusCodereadyWorkspaces codereadyWorkspaces;
public static final String SERIALIZED_NAME_COLLECTION_CONTROLLER = "collectionController";
@SerializedName(SERIALIZED_NAME_COLLECTION_CONTROLLER)
private KabaneroStatusCollectionController collectionController;
public static final String SERIALIZED_NAME_EVENTS = "events";
@SerializedName(SERIALIZED_NAME_EVENTS)
private KabaneroStatusEvents events;
public static final String SERIALIZED_NAME_KABANERO_INSTANCE = "kabaneroInstance";
@SerializedName(SERIALIZED_NAME_KABANERO_INSTANCE)
private KabaneroStatusKabaneroInstance kabaneroInstance;
public static final String SERIALIZED_NAME_KAPPNAV = "kappnav";
@SerializedName(SERIALIZED_NAME_KAPPNAV)
private KabaneroStatusKappnav kappnav;
public static final String SERIALIZED_NAME_LANDING = "landing";
@SerializedName(SERIALIZED_NAME_LANDING)
private KabaneroStatusLanding landing;
public static final String SERIALIZED_NAME_SERVERLESS = "serverless";
@SerializedName(SERIALIZED_NAME_SERVERLESS)
private KabaneroStatusServerless serverless;
public static final String SERIALIZED_NAME_SSO = "sso";
@SerializedName(SERIALIZED_NAME_SSO)
private KabaneroStatusSso sso;
public static final String SERIALIZED_NAME_STACK_CONTROLLER = "stackController";
@SerializedName(SERIALIZED_NAME_STACK_CONTROLLER)
private KabaneroStatusStackController stackController;
public static final String SERIALIZED_NAME_TEKTON = "tekton";
@SerializedName(SERIALIZED_NAME_TEKTON)
private KabaneroStatusTekton tekton;
public KabaneroStatus admissionControllerWebhook(KabaneroStatusAdmissionControllerWebhook admissionControllerWebhook) {
this.admissionControllerWebhook = admissionControllerWebhook;
return this;
}
/**
* Get admissionControllerWebhook
* @return admissionControllerWebhook
**/
@javax.annotation.Nullable
@ApiModelProperty(value = "")
public KabaneroStatusAdmissionControllerWebhook getAdmissionControllerWebhook() {
return admissionControllerWebhook;
}
public void setAdmissionControllerWebhook(KabaneroStatusAdmissionControllerWebhook admissionControllerWebhook) {
this.admissionControllerWebhook = admissionControllerWebhook;
}
public KabaneroStatus appsody(KabaneroStatusAppsody appsody) {
this.appsody = appsody;
return this;
}
/**
* Get appsody
* @return appsody
**/
@javax.annotation.Nullable
@ApiModelProperty(value = "")
public KabaneroStatusAppsody getAppsody() {
return appsody;
}
public void setAppsody(KabaneroStatusAppsody appsody) {
this.appsody = appsody;
}
public KabaneroStatus cli(KabaneroStatusCli cli) {
this.cli = cli;
return this;
}
/**
* Get cli
* @return cli
**/
@javax.annotation.Nullable
@ApiModelProperty(value = "")
public KabaneroStatusCli getCli() {
return cli;
}
public void setCli(KabaneroStatusCli cli) {
this.cli = cli;
}
public KabaneroStatus codereadyWorkspaces(KabaneroStatusCodereadyWorkspaces codereadyWorkspaces) {
this.codereadyWorkspaces = codereadyWorkspaces;
return this;
}
/**
* Get codereadyWorkspaces
* @return codereadyWorkspaces
**/
@javax.annotation.Nullable
@ApiModelProperty(value = "")
public KabaneroStatusCodereadyWorkspaces getCodereadyWorkspaces() {
return codereadyWorkspaces;
}
public void setCodereadyWorkspaces(KabaneroStatusCodereadyWorkspaces codereadyWorkspaces) {
this.codereadyWorkspaces = codereadyWorkspaces;
}
public KabaneroStatus collectionController(KabaneroStatusCollectionController collectionController) {
this.collectionController = collectionController;
return this;
}
/**
* Get collectionController
* @return collectionController
**/
@javax.annotation.Nullable
@ApiModelProperty(value = "")
public KabaneroStatusCollectionController getCollectionController() {
return collectionController;
}
public void setCollectionController(KabaneroStatusCollectionController collectionController) {
this.collectionController = collectionController;
}
public KabaneroStatus events(KabaneroStatusEvents events) {
this.events = events;
return this;
}
/**
* Get events
* @return events
**/
@javax.annotation.Nullable
@ApiModelProperty(value = "")
public KabaneroStatusEvents getEvents() {
return events;
}
public void setEvents(KabaneroStatusEvents events) {
this.events = events;
}
public KabaneroStatus kabaneroInstance(KabaneroStatusKabaneroInstance kabaneroInstance) {
this.kabaneroInstance = kabaneroInstance;
return this;
}
/**
* Get kabaneroInstance
* @return kabaneroInstance
**/
@javax.annotation.Nullable
@ApiModelProperty(value = "")
public KabaneroStatusKabaneroInstance getKabaneroInstance() {
return kabaneroInstance;
}
public void setKabaneroInstance(KabaneroStatusKabaneroInstance kabaneroInstance) {
this.kabaneroInstance = kabaneroInstance;
}
public KabaneroStatus kappnav(KabaneroStatusKappnav kappnav) {
this.kappnav = kappnav;
return this;
}
/**
* Get kappnav
* @return kappnav
**/
@javax.annotation.Nullable
@ApiModelProperty(value = "")
public KabaneroStatusKappnav getKappnav() {
return kappnav;
}
public void setKappnav(KabaneroStatusKappnav kappnav) {
this.kappnav = kappnav;
}
public KabaneroStatus landing(KabaneroStatusLanding landing) {
this.landing = landing;
return this;
}
/**
* Get landing
* @return landing
**/
@javax.annotation.Nullable
@ApiModelProperty(value = "")
public KabaneroStatusLanding getLanding() {
return landing;
}
public void setLanding(KabaneroStatusLanding landing) {
this.landing = landing;
}
public KabaneroStatus serverless(KabaneroStatusServerless serverless) {
this.serverless = serverless;
return this;
}
/**
* Get serverless
* @return serverless
**/
@javax.annotation.Nullable
@ApiModelProperty(value = "")
public KabaneroStatusServerless getServerless() {
return serverless;
}
public void setServerless(KabaneroStatusServerless serverless) {
this.serverless = serverless;
}
public KabaneroStatus sso(KabaneroStatusSso sso) {
this.sso = sso;
return this;
}
/**
* Get sso
* @return sso
**/
@javax.annotation.Nullable
@ApiModelProperty(value = "")
public KabaneroStatusSso getSso() {
return sso;
}
public void setSso(KabaneroStatusSso sso) {
this.sso = sso;
}
public KabaneroStatus stackController(KabaneroStatusStackController stackController) {
this.stackController = stackController;
return this;
}
/**
* Get stackController
* @return stackController
**/
@javax.annotation.Nullable
@ApiModelProperty(value = "")
public KabaneroStatusStackController getStackController() {
return stackController;
}
public void setStackController(KabaneroStatusStackController stackController) {
this.stackController = stackController;
}
public KabaneroStatus tekton(KabaneroStatusTekton tekton) {
this.tekton = tekton;
return this;
}
/**
* Get tekton
* @return tekton
**/
@javax.annotation.Nullable
@ApiModelProperty(value = "")
public KabaneroStatusTekton getTekton() {
return tekton;
}
public void setTekton(KabaneroStatusTekton tekton) {
this.tekton = tekton;
}
@Override
public boolean equals(java.lang.Object o) {
return EqualsBuilder.reflectionEquals(this, o);
}
@Override
public int hashCode() {
return HashCodeBuilder.reflectionHashCode(this);
}
@Override
public String toString() {
StringBuilder sb = new StringBuilder();
sb.append("class KabaneroStatus {\n");
sb.append(" admissionControllerWebhook: ").append(toIndentedString(admissionControllerWebhook)).append("\n");
sb.append(" appsody: ").append(toIndentedString(appsody)).append("\n");
sb.append(" cli: ").append(toIndentedString(cli)).append("\n");
sb.append(" codereadyWorkspaces: ").append(toIndentedString(codereadyWorkspaces)).append("\n");
sb.append(" collectionController: ").append(toIndentedString(collectionController)).append("\n");
sb.append(" events: ").append(toIndentedString(events)).append("\n");
sb.append(" kabaneroInstance: ").append(toIndentedString(kabaneroInstance)).append("\n");
sb.append(" kappnav: ").append(toIndentedString(kappnav)).append("\n");
sb.append(" landing: ").append(toIndentedString(landing)).append("\n");
sb.append(" serverless: ").append(toIndentedString(serverless)).append("\n");
sb.append(" sso: ").append(toIndentedString(sso)).append("\n");
sb.append(" stackController: ").append(toIndentedString(stackController)).append("\n");
sb.append(" tekton: ").append(toIndentedString(tekton)).append("\n");
sb.append("}");
return sb.toString();
}
/**
* Convert the given object to string with each line indented by 4 spaces
* (except the first line).
*/
private String toIndentedString(java.lang.Object o) {
if (o == null) {
return "null";
}
return o.toString().replace("\n", "\n ");
}
}
© 2015 - 2025 Weber Informatics LLC | Privacy Policy